ESCONDIDO, CA — A pedestrian was struck by a vehicle and killed Sunday evening in Escondido.
The fatal crash was reported to the California Highway Patrol at 9:22 p.m and occurred on the eastbound Ronald Packard (78) Parkway east of Centre City Parkway.
The pedestrian was pronounced dead at the scene, the CHP said.
All eastbound lanes were shut down for the investigation, and traffic was diverted off at Centre City Parkway.
